Junior Accountant
Role Overview & Responsibilities
Job Description
As the Junior Finance Assistant you will be responsible for the following:
- Assisting with weekly and monthly reporting
- Processing invoices on the sales and purchase ledger
- Reconciling transactions on Xero
- Processing expenses
- Cash monitoring and reconciliation
- Credit card monitoring and reconciliation
- Updating monthly spreadsheets
The Successful Applicant
To be considered for this Junior Accountant role you must have the following:
- Part qualified or / Studying towards a qualification
- Strong excel skills
- Office experience, ideally in an accounting role
